This is the sixth edition of Sydney Annual, and reflecting upon our achievements over that time, I am proud to say that the University of Sydney family is poised to accomplish significant advances.

While many countries of the world were facing financial crises in 2008 and 2009, remarkably the University’s family of donors grew by more than 20 percent. This unprecedented trend continued throughout 2010, and by the end of 2011 there were almost 9000 donors. This is greater than any other year in our history. This growth has enabled the University to reach an amazing total of over $79 million, for which we are indeed grateful.
